body{background-color:#fafafa;font-family:apertura,Arial,sans-serif}p{font-size:18px;line-height:26px;color:#000}h1,h2{font-family:tomarik-brush,sans-serif;color:#1f451f}h1{font-size:40px;line-height:54px;font-weight:400}h1.page-title{margin-bottom:40px}h1.entry-title{margin-bottom:30px}h2{font-size:32px;line-height:48px;font-weight:400}h3,p.intro,.intro>p{font-size:28px;line-height:34px;font-family:apertura,Arial,sans-serif;color:#0e3b43}h4{font-family:apertura,Arial,sans-serif;font-size:24px;line-height:24px;color:#2b6750;font-weight:500}hr{border-bottom:0 none;height:48px;overflow:hidden;margin:0 0 1.5rem;text-align:center}hr:after{content:"............................................";letter-spacing:16px;color:#198da2;font-size:60px;line-height:30px;text-align:center}#topnav{background-color:#4caa6d;height:72px;overflow:hidden}#subnav{background-color:#1d504d;height:111px}#subnav .logo{position:absolute;z-index:10;height:185px;top:-72px;left:-4px}#subnav .grid-container{position:relative}.search-form label>span{display:none}.search-form{float:right;width:200px;border:1px solid #fff;border-radius:8px;padding:.35rem .5rem;height:52px;margin-right:1.25rem;margin-top:9px}.search-form input[type="search"]{color:#fff;background:transparent;padding:0;font-size:18px;margin-bottom:0;width:140px;border:0;box-shadow:0 0 0 transparent}.search-form input[type="search"]::placeholder{color:#fff}.search-form input[type="search"]:focus{border:0 none;outline:0;box-shadow:0 0 0 transparent}.search-form label{display:inline-block}.search-form input[type="submit"]{display:inline-block;width:24px;height:23px;background:transparent url(https://www.sunflowersdaynursery.com/wp-content/themes/JointsWP-CSS-master/assets/images/search-icon.png) no-repeat left top;background-size:24px 23px;cursor:pointer;margin-left:.5rem;text-indent:-9999px;margin:auto 0}.dropdown.menu>li>a{color:#fff!important;font-family:apertura,Arial,sans-serif;font-size:22px;font-weight:bold;line-height:27px;transition:.25s all;border-radius:10px}.dropdown.menu>li.menu-item-has-children>a:hover,.dropdown.menu>li.menu-item-has-children.is-active>a{border-bottom-left-radius:0;border-bottom-right-radius:0}.dropdown.menu>li{margin-right:14px}.dropdown.menu>li:last-child{margin-right:0}.menu .active>a,.dropdown.menu>li.is-active>a,.dropdown.menu>li>a:hover{color:#fff;background:#102927 0% 0% no-repeat padding-box}.dropdown.menu.medium-horizontal>li.is-dropdown-submenu-parent>a{padding-right:2rem}.dropdown.menu.medium-horizontal>li.is-dropdown-submenu-parent>a::after{border-color:#fff transparent transparent;right:10px}#main-nav{margin-top:30px}.is-dropdown-submenu{border:0 solid #cacaca;background:#102927;border-bottom-left-radius:10px;border-bottom-right-radius:10px;min-width:100%}.dropdown .is-dropdown-submenu a{color:#fff}.dropdown .is-dropdown-submenu a:hover{background-color:#1d504d}.breadcrumbs{margin:0 0 2rem 0;list-style:none;padding-bottom:1.5rem;border-bottom:4px dotted #4ba2b1}.breadcrumbs li{float:left;font-size:14px;line-height:18px;font-family:Apertura,sans-serif;font-weight:500;color:#626262;cursor:default;text-transform:none}.breadcrumbs a{color:#626262}.breadcrumbs li:not(:last-child)::after {position:relative;margin:0 .25rem;opacity:1;content:"/";color:#626262}.content{min-height:600px;padding-top:4rem;background-color:#ededed;padding-bottom:8rem}.off-canvas-wrapper{background-color:#ededed}.slide-container{min-height:600px;background-size:cover;background-repeat:no-repeat;background-position:left top}.slide-inner{position:relative}.slide-text-container{position:absolute;top:6rem;left:0}.banner-title{background-color:rgba(255,255,255,.8);padding:.5rem 1rem .15rem 1rem;font-family:tomarik-brush,sans-serif;font-size:40px;line-height:64px;font-weight:400;color:#1f451f;border-top-right-radius:10px;border-top-left-radius:10px;border-bottom-right-radius:10px;width:auto}.banner-subtitle{color:#fff;font-size:28px;padding:.65rem 1rem;background-color:#4caa6d;border-bottom-right-radius:10px;border-bottom-left-radius:10px;width:auto;display:inline-block}.home .wpv-pagination-nav-links-container{z-index:1000;margin-top:-100px;margin-bottom:80px;text-align:right;max-width:75rem;margin-left:auto;margin-right:auto}.pagination-dots>li>a.page-link{background-color:#fefefe;border-color:#fefefe;width:22px;height:22px}.pagination-dots>li{margin-left:2rem}.pagination-dots>li:first-child{margin-left:0}.pagination-dots>li.active-dot>a,.pagination-dots>li>a.page-link:hover{background-color:#1d504d;border-color:#1d504d}.home .content{padding-top:0}.team{margin-bottom:1rem}.team h4{font-weight:700;font-size:26px;line-height:33px;color:#000;margin:0 0 .25rem 0}.team a h4{color:#000}.team .role{font-size:18px;color:#2b6750;line-height:33px;margin-bottom:.25rem;font-weight:bold}.team a .role{color:#626262}.team .excerpt{font-size:18px;color:#4e4e4e;line-height:26px}#nf-form-title-2{display:none}.caldera-grid form, 
form.cred-user-form,
.page-id-397:not(.logged-in) article {border-radius:20px;padding:2rem;background-color:#fff}#nf-form-2-cont{border-radius:20px;padding:0 2rem;background-color:#fff}h3.form-title,
.page-id-397:not(.logged-in) article h1.page-title {margin:-32px -47px 2rem -32px;background-color:#3d8f70;padding:1.25rem 2rem 1rem 2rem;color:#fff;font-size:40px;line-height:64px;font-family:tomarik-brush,sans-serif;border-top-right-radius:20px;border-top-left-radius:20px}.page-id-397:not(.logged-in) article h1.page-title,
.page-id-397 h3.form-title {background-color:#4caa6d;margin:-32px -32px 2rem -32px}.caldera-grid form label, 
form.cred-user-form label,
.page-id-397:not(.logged-in) article form label {color:#08252b;font-size:26px;line-height:32px;margin-bottom:.5rem}.nf-form-content label{color:#08252b!important;font-size:26px!important;line-height:32px!important;margin-bottom:.5rem!important}.caldera-grid form input[type="text"],
.caldera-grid form input[type="email"],
.caldera-grid form input[type="password"],
form.cred-user-form input[type="text"],
form.cred-user-form input[type="email"],
form.cred-user-form input[type="password"],
.page-id-397:not(.logged-in) article form input[type="text"],
.page-id-397:not(.logged-in) article form input[type="email"],
.page-id-397:not(.logged-in) article form input[type="password"] {background-color:#fff;border:1px solid #d0d3d0;height:64px;padding:.5rem;box-sizing:border-box}.caldera-grid input[type="submit"],
form.cred-user-form input[type="submit"],
.page-id-397:not(.logged-in) article form input[type="submit"] {background:#3d8f70;color:#fff;font-size:26px;font-weight:700;line-height:32px;padding:1rem 2rem;text-align:center;border-radius:10px;transition:all .25s}.nf-form-content input[type="submit"]{background:#3d8f70!important;color:#fff!important;font-size:26px!important;font-weight:700!important;line-height:32px!important;padding:1rem 2rem!important;text-align:center!important;border-radius:10px!important;transition:all .25s!important;cursor:pointer;height:60px!important}form.cred-user-form input[type="submit"],
.page-id-397:not(.logged-in) article form input[type="submit"] {background:#4caa6d}.caldera-grid input[type="submit"]:hover,
form.cred-user-form input[type="submit"]:hover,
.page-id-397:not(.logged-in) article form input[type="submit"]:hover {background-color:#1d504d;color:#fff}.nf-form-content input[type="submit"]:hover{background-color:#1d504d!important;color:#fff!important}.logged-in.page-id-397 h1.page-title{display:none}.forgot-pwd{width:auto;float:right;margin-top:-90px}#post-31 .article-header{display:none}#grassverge{height:96px;background:transparent url(https://www.sunflowersdaynursery.com/wp-content/themes/JointsWP-CSS-master/assets/images/layer3.png) repeat-x 50% top;margin-top:-60px}#superfooter{margin:0;background-color:#2b6750;padding-bottom:3rem}#superfooter p{color:#fff;font-size:14px;line-height:20px}#superfooter p a.contact{color:#fff;font-size:18px;font-weight:bold;margin-left:2rem}.footer-right{text-align:right}#subfooter{margin:0;padding:1rem 0;background-color:#214e3d}#subfooter p,#subfooter a{color:#fff;font-size:12px;line-height:18px}.ofsted>img{width:100px;float:left;margin-right:1.5rem}a.social{display:inline-block;width:24px;height:24px;text-indent:9999px;margin-left:1.5rem}a.social.twitter{background:transparent url(https://www.sunflowersdaynursery.com/wp-content/themes/JointsWP-CSS-master/assets/images/twitter-icon.svg) no-repeat left top;background-size:24px 24px}a.social.email{background:transparent url(https://www.sunflowersdaynursery.com/wp-content/themes/JointsWP-CSS-master/assets/images/email-icon.svg) no-repeat left top;background-size:24px 24px}a.social.facebook{background:transparent url(https://www.sunflowersdaynursery.com/wp-content/themes/JointsWP-CSS-master/assets/images/facebook-icon.svg) no-repeat left top;background-size:24px 24px}#subfooter .linkies a{margin-right:1rem}.cell.news{margin-top:2rem;padding-bottom:1rem;border-bottom:4px dotted #4ba2b1;margin-bottom:1rem}.news h4{font-weight:700;line-height:33px;font-size:26px;margin-top:0;margin-bottom:.75rem}.news p:last-child{margin-bottom:0}.list-pager .pagination{margin:2rem 0;text-align:right;width:auto;display:inherit}.list-pager .page-link{background-color:transparent;color:#2b6750;font-size:18px;border-radius:5px}.list-pager .active .page-link{background-color:rgba(76,170,166,.45)}.entry-content img.wp-post-image,.news-image>img{margin-bottom:20px}.wp-block-separator{border-top:0;border-bottom:0}.wp-block-image{margin-bottom:2rem}.menu-icon{background:transparent url(https://www.sunflowersdaynursery.com/wp-content/themes/JointsWP-CSS-master/assets/images/burger.png) no-repeat left top;background-size:34px 24px;width:34px;height:24px}.menu-icon::after{display:none}.menu-icon:hover{opacity:.8}#off-canvas{background-color:#1d504d}#offcanvas-nav li a{color:#d6faff;font-size:17px;font-weight:bold;background-color:transparent}#offcanvas-nav li a:hover,#offcanvas-nav li.active>a,.dropdown.menu>li.is-active>a,.dropdown.menu>li>a:hover{color:#d6faff;background-color:#102927}#offcanvas-nav{display:block;width:100%;clear:both}#off-canvas .widget_search{overflow:hidden;margin-bottom:2rem}.accordion-menu .is-accordion-submenu-parent:not(.has-submenu-toggle) > a::after {border-color:#d6faff transparent transparent}#offcanvas-nav li ul.submenu{background-color:#102927}#offcanvas-nav li ul.submenu li a:hover,#offcanvas-nav li ul.submenu li.active>a{color:#d6faff;background-color:#1d504d}.accordion-menu a{padding:1rem 1rem}.search-results article h2>a{color:#214e3d}.search-results article h2>a:hover{text-decoration:underline}